An unusually cloudy and breezy (and dusty) London Fields greeted Run Director Rue, Marshall (and nearly tail walker) Sooz and timekeeper Nick this morning - after the past few weeks of bright sunshine and warm temperatures it was something of a welcome change. We were also delighted to be joined by John, who eagerly donned the hi viz and stood ready for instruction on where Rue wanted him deployed - the marshall post by the playground became his chosen spot for today.

As we now seem to be very much into summer holiday season, we stood under the big tree at 0845 somewhat in anticipation of how many enthusiastic runners we'd get, but they soon started appearing from all directions, including two absolute first timers, and in the end 22 stood poised on the windy start line awaiting the off...and then they were gone, and soon spread out in a long line around the edge of the fields - our intrepid Tail Walker Johnny (who to be fair had a small person on his shoulders) struggled to keep up with the pace!

After just over 8 minutes our lead runner headed down the finishing straight followed by a neatly spaced sequence of out of breath runners, of whom 6 set new PBs, which was going some in today's wind. At the end we sadly bid farewell to Johnny one of our long time RDs today as he heads to deepest Kent to take on a new job, and who, along with his wife and two children, have been huge supporters of London Fields junior parkrun for such a long time - they will all be missed, especially when it comes to token sorting at the end of each event...

parkrun organise free, weekly, 2km timed runs for young people around the world. They are open to 4-14 year olds, free, and are safe and easy to take part in.
